Purines and uric acid

Introduction: Purines and uric acid. Purines are nitrogenous bases of DNA. It is a heterocyclic aromatic compound consisting of two fused rings. Basic purine’s structure consists of nine atoms. It has involved in the catabolism of uric acid.

Catabolism is the chemical breakdown of a substance. Break down of purines produce uric acid and has been found in some drinks and food. Uric acid dissolves in blood and travels to the kidney for purification.

Food to increase uric acid

Introduction: Food to increase uric acid. Uric acid is a natural substance that which body produces as a by-product of the breakdown of purines. It is the waste product present in the blood.

Food and drinks high in purines also elevate uric acid. Increased uric acid levels can also cause gout, a condition caused by the accumulation of uric acid from poor dietary habits.
